fetal liver

The fetal liver is a vital organ in developing babies before birth. It plays a key role in producing blood cells, storing nutrients, and helping process and filter waste from the developing body. The liver also helps in producing important substances for growth and blood clotting. As the fetus grows, the liver gradually takes on more functions until the infant’s own organs are ready to do so after birth. It’s a crucial component of fetal development, supporting overall health and growth inside the womb.
